Canaries goes indoors for rally opener

Rally Islas Canarias will start their 47th edition in unique fashion with the rally-opening super special stage set to run through Gran Canaria Arena, better known as home of Liga ACB basketball team CB Gran Canaria.

The DISA Super Special Stage will be one of the most unique to ever take place in the 70-year history of the FIA European Rally Championship, with competitors required to navigate into Gran Canaria Arena and execute a donut before continuing with the stage.

Taking place at 22:05 CET on 4 May, the stage acts as the opening test of weekend at slightly under 2km. The remaining 188km competitive kilometres take place over Friday and Saturday, concluding with the powerstage at 18:05 CET on Saturday evening.

The unique stage is the culmination of hard work done between the rally organisers, stadium management and CB Gran Canaria - one of Spain's elite basketball teams. They current sit sixth in the Spanish championship and atop their group in the European-wide Eurocup. 

To announce the special collaboration, rally organisers employed star player Khalifa Diop and local rally drivers Armide Martín and Emma Falcón, both of whom will compete in May's rally.
